Handover: the Brambleworks formula sandbox now runs user expressions in an isolated evaluator with a strict opcode allowlist and a 50ms budget. Recursion depth is capped at 32; anything beyond raises a SandboxLimit error. Tests cover injection attempts and timeout paths. Please review the allowlist changes carefully. Questions during review should go to the owner listed below.

account owner for bawip-tahag: Raleth Quenok

Runbook: FeedTrue validator account recovery. If the Castwick admin account locks after failed RSS audit logins, validation jobs stall queue-wide. Do not recreate the account; history is keyed to it. Run the recovery CLI, select the validator identity, and supply the passphrase shown on the line below.

unlock words, hahip-baduf: holwyn-istath-julvan

## Step 4 — Configure DedupeBot

DedupeBot squashes duplicate pages from the Nightwarden alert stream so on-call folks aren't buzzed five times for one outage. Set DEDUPE_WINDOW_SECS=300 and DEDUPE_KEY_FIELDS=service,region in the env file — don't get clever with the window or real alerts get eaten. It also needs a token to ack alerts upstream, added on this next line.

vault entry, yahif-yajep: COURIER_KEY29=b802bdf8034096b65a51c6ba5abe2

## Deploy Step 6: Query Planner Hotfix (Tidemark 5.2.1)

Support team: this release reverts the planner change that caused full scans on the orders table. After deploying, verify the fix by running the saved diagnostic query and confirming it completes under two seconds. The diagnostic runner connects with its own restricted database role, so before running it, append the following line to the runner's env file:

env line for yahip-tafog: RELAY_SECRET3=4ca